On a class of inverse problems with Cauchy Data for quasilinear parabolic equations

N. L. Gol'dman

Lomonosov Moscow State University, Research Computing Center

Abstract: The questions of uniqueness in Hölder classes are investigated for inverse problems with overspecified boundary data. These problems are connected with determination of an unknown right-hand side in a general-type quasilinear parabolic equation. The quasi-solution method for construction of stable approximate solutions for this class of ill-posed problems is substantiated.

Keywords: inverse problems, quasilinear parabolic equations, uniqueness, quasi-solution method, ill-posed problems.
